How Do You Make A Donation To The American Heart Association?

0

The American Heart Association is an important organization that is dedicated to education about heart disease and funding medical research that will help future generations avoid heart disease; something that effects us or someone we know every day. It doesn’t take much time or money to help this important non-profit organization. Go to the American Heart Association website. At the very top of the page click the donate button. Decide what kind of donation you want to make. You can make a Tribute donation to AHA to honor a survivor of heart disease that you know. You can make a Memorial donation to AHA to honor the memory of someone you know that has died of heart disease. Or you can make a general donation to help fight heart disease. The minimum donation for The American Heart Association is two dollars.
